ADA Web Lawsuits Are Still Climbing
The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) requires business websites to be usable by disabled people. Courts have increasingly treated public-facing websites as covered, which is why accessibility barriers can lead to demand letters, lawsuits, and settlement pressure.
EcomBack counted 3,948 ADA website lawsuits in 2025, and UsableNet tracked 441 digital accessibility lawsuits in February 2026 alone.

Judgment-stage numbers are harder to generalize because relatively few website cases actually run that far. These examples use legal and bar-publication sources instead of vendor estimates.
$55K
Defense fees and costs award in a litigated hotel website case
JMBM reported a July 19, 2023 ruling awarding about $55,000 in attorneys' fees and costs after the defense prevailed in Zarco Hotels.
$4K + fees
California damages can still come with attorneys' fees and costs
The American Bar Association notes Midvale affirmed $4,000 in statutory damages plus attorneys' fees and costs under California law.
5 years
A contested federal case can drag on for years
The American Bar Association says Domino's lost after nearly five years of intensive litigation, with plaintiff fees likely much higher than the damages award.
FTC Final Order Against accessiBe
The FTC finalized a $1 million order and barred unsupported claims that an automated product can make any site WCAG-compliant.
Repeat Defendants Stay Exposed
UsableNet reported 1,427 lawsuits against companies that had already been sued. In federal court, 46% of cases involved repeat defendants.
DOJ Title II Web Rule Deadlines Begin
ADA.gov says larger public entities must meet WCAG 2.1 AA by Apr 24, 2026. Smaller entities follow in 2027.

Yes. EcomBack counted 3,948 ADA website accessibility lawsuits in 2025, up 23.84% from 2024. UsableNet then logged 441 digital accessibility lawsuits in February 2026 alone. For a small business, that risk usually shows up first as a demand letter, settlement pressure, and a rush to fix the site under a deadline.
No. EcomBack counted 983 website lawsuits against sites using accessibility widgets in 2025. The FTC's April 2025 final order against accessiBe also barred unsupported claims that an automated product can make any website WCAG-compliant. A widget may change the interface, but it does not fix the code-level barriers plaintiffs keep suing over.

In 2025, EcomBack found restaurants and food sites led website lawsuits at 34.65%, followed by fashion and apparel at 25.96%, beauty and personal care at 8.03%, home and furniture at 7.67%, and health and medical at 7.17%. New York, Florida, California, and Illinois accounted for 86.65% of filings. If your site drives ordering, booking, shopping, or patient-service flows, your exposure is higher.
